Freshness Enhances Natural Flavour

Mediterranean cuisine focuses on allowing ingredients to speak for themselves. Instead of relying on heavy sauces or artificial seasonings, dishes are prepared with simple techniques that highlight the natural taste of each component.

Fresh vegetables bring crisp texture and bright flavour. Fresh herbs add aroma and depth. High-quality olive oil enhances richness without overpowering the dish. When ingredients are fresh, every bite feels balanced and clean.

Balance and Simplicity

One defining feature of Mediterranean cooking is balance. Fresh ingredients help create harmony between savoury, acidic, and herbal elements.
For example:

  • Olive oil adds richness.
  • Lemon adds brightness.
  • Garlic adds depth.
  • Fresh herbs add aroma.

When everything is fresh, these components blend naturally. The result is food that feels satisfying without being heavy.
